For a more interactive and engaging experience, consider setting up a mini pizza-making station. Provide pre-made pizza dough rounds, various sauces (marinara, pesto, alfredo), an assortment of toppings, and let your guests create their own personalized pizzas. This is a fantastic activity for kids, allowing them to express their creativity and customize their own culinary masterpiece.

Other creative pizza twists include pizza rolls or pizza bites, which are easy-to-eat snacks perfect for little hands. You could also prepare pizza skewers, threading mozzarella balls, cherry tomatoes, pepperoni slices, and olives onto skewers and drizzling them with a tangy pizza sauce. Calzones, individual pockets of pizza goodness filled with various cheeses, meats, and vegetables, are another great option for a satisfying and personalized treat.

Shell-tastic Snacks Inspired by the Turtles

Beyond the pizza, the real fun begins. Let’s tap into the turtles’ world with snacks inspired by their personalities, colors, and environment.

Let’s start with green-themed treats. Embrace the turtles’ iconic color with “Sewer Sludge” dip. This could be a delicious spinach artichoke dip or creamy guacamole, served with a variety of tortilla chips for dipping. Offer green veggie sticks with ranch dressing, including celery, cucumber, and green bell peppers, providing a healthy and refreshing option. Green fruit skewers, featuring grapes, kiwi, and green apple slices, add a touch of sweetness and visual appeal. Edamame, steamed and lightly salted, is a fun and nutritious snack that even the turtles would appreciate. And don’t forget pistachios or other green nuts for a crunchy and satisfying nibble.

Create turtle shell-shaped snacks to reinforce the theme. Cut cheese slices into shell shapes using cookie cutters or serve cheese with round crackers. You can also bake turtle shell cookies, using a turtle-shaped cookie cutter or decorating round cookies with icing and sprinkles to resemble a shell. Turtle shell pretzels, made by dipping pretzels in melted chocolate and decorating them with colorful M&Ms or sprinkles, are a sweet and salty treat that kids will adore.

Cowabunga Main Courses (Beyond Pizza)

While pizza is the star, diversify your menu with some creative main courses.

Consider “Turtle Power” pasta salad. Prepare a green pasta salad with a variety of vegetables like broccoli, peas, and green bell peppers. Using farfalle (bowtie) pasta adds a fun and whimsical touch that resembles little bow ties.

“Sewer Pipe” mac and cheese is another crowd-pleaser. Serve the mac and cheese in a fun and unexpected container, such as a small, clean PVC pipe section. Important safety note: Ensure that the pipe is thoroughly cleaned and sanitized before using it for food. You could also use sturdy paper cups decorated to look like sewer pipes.

Offer Ninja Turtle burger bites: Mini burgers with green-tinted cheese or toppings like avocado slices will be a hit.

“Krang’s Brain” meatballs add a touch of playful spookiness. Prepare meatballs in a slightly unusual but delicious sauce, such as a tangy BBQ sauce or a sweet and sour glaze. This adds a unique twist and sparks conversation.

And finally, “Turtle Soup” a hearty vegetable soup filled with green vegetables, provides a nutritious and comforting option.

Drinks & Desserts

No party is complete without refreshing drinks and decadent desserts.

For drinks, create “Mutagen Ooze” punch: A vibrant green punch made with lime sherbet, pineapple juice, and ginger ale. Add gummy worms or edible glitter for an extra dose of fun. You could also offer “Turtle Power” smoothies: Green smoothies made with spinach, banana, and your favorite fruits. Serve bottled water with custom TMNT labels featuring the turtles’ faces or their signature catchphrases.

For desserts, TMNT cupcakes are a classic and easy option. Frost cupcakes with green frosting and add candy eyes. Use the bandana colors – red, blue, orange, and purple – to create cupcakes representing each turtle. A Turtle Cake decorated to look like a turtle shell or featuring the TMNT characters is a show-stopping centerpiece. “Ooze” brownies, brownies with a green slime glaze made from melted white chocolate and green food coloring, are a fun and spooky treat. Finally, set up an ice cream sundae bar with various toppings, allowing guests to create their own TMNT-themed sundaes.
